That's a gazelle hook. The smash punch was basically a modified shovel hook with the lead hand but instead of keeping the arm bent you extend it. It was so effective for Ruddock bc of his long arms and long legs. Its good bc the angle it comes from may make it difficult to see coming but its bad bc if you miss you're wide open.
